I rang 3 different dealerships to find out if my 2016 C63S Sedan required this to be done as forum discussions were that some cars required the diff oil to be changed and some didn't.
None of the dealerships knew anything about it and had to go away and come back to advise me my car didn't require the oil change.
On closer inspection of the run in stickers on the windscreen the second smaller sticker stated that the diff oil did in fact need to be changed so I took it in and it was done for free.
I was pretty annoyed that even the Mercedes dealerships didn't know this had to be done and even advised me that it didn't.
Anyway, done while I waited and for free through Corporate Servicing Plan.

Done the same on multiple AMG's in the past; I use my independent tech and the pricing is much lower and time you wait is much less. Obviously if one has bought a pre paid plan its more beneficial to take advantage of that.
The change is literally:
put car on lift
unplug the diff drain plug
drain
replug
fill from the side of the diff
Now this was on my Black Series and a 3 M157 cars so the M177 may differ and I didn't have to do this on my M178 GTS (probably due it being electronic vs mechanical).
